Hi Tomas, welcome aboard. Quick summary of last night's cut-over: we moved rate limiting on the Drayloft internal API gateway from the per-node token buckets to the shared Quorin limiter. Burst handling is now centralized, so the old per-service overrides are ignored. Watch the 429 dashboard for the first week; the thresholds are deliberately conservative. The limiter now runs with the configuration values shown below, which you should treat as canonical.

service settings:
novath:
  pin: 1396
  tenant: pelys
  seal: seal_ccc035e1
  metrics_host: metrics.novath.qorvelworks.test
  standby_team: fraeth
  escalation: drueth-zorok
  nonce: 61d508

### Step 4: Apply the expand phase

Quillback schema migrations run in expand/contract pairs. Apply the expand migration first; both old and new app versions must work against it before you cut traffic. Support should hold any ticket about missing columns until contract completes. Do not run contract within 24 hours of expand. The migration runner reads these settings at startup.

service settings:
PRAIX_LOG_LEVEL=error
PRAIX_METRICS_HOST=metrics.praix.qorvelcorp.corp
PRAIX_POOL_SIZE=16

**Handover: Tidyvine branch-cleanup bot**

While I'm out, Tidyvine keeps running on its usual schedule, scanning for branches with no commits in the stale window and opening deletion proposals. It never force-deletes; a human must approve. Known quirk: it occasionally re-flags branches restored from archive, so double-check before approving anything touched in the last week. If it misbehaves, pause the scheduler first, then inspect state. The current production settings are the following.

settings of tagef-bawif:
DRUIX_HOST=druix.zemvarlabs.internal
DRUIX_PORT=8000

### Step 4: Update the locker access flow

In Sudsport v3, the laundry-locker open sequence no longer issues a one-time PIN directly; your plugin must request a grant token, then exchange it within sixty seconds. Plugins still calling the legacy open endpoint will receive a deprecation error after the cutover. Test against the staging hub in Marletby before shipping. Exchange requests must be signed, and your plugin environment needs the following configuration values set.

service settings:
[casax]
port = 6379
team = rusir
host = casax.zemvarhq.corp
region = outer-4
access_code = ac_9808ce
timeout_ms = 1500